Abstract

The utility model discloses a novel armed police fire-fighting boot which comprises a boot bottom, wherein the bottom of the boot bottom is fixedly connected with an anti-skidding bulge, the top of the boot bottom is fixedly connected with a boot surface, the surface of the boot surface is connected with a protective sleeve in a sleeved mode, and one side of the protective sleeve is fixedly connected with a transmission assembly. According to the utility model, the limiting assembly is movably connected to the top of the illuminating assembly, the clamping block can be clamped into the clamping groove, the upper end opening of the boot leg can be tightened by matching with the elastic band, the requirement of keeping fit with legs of firefighters of different body types can be met, the working efficiency of the firefighters can be improved, the first limiting rod is separated from the first limiting groove by pulling the first limiting rod, the clamping block can be conveniently detached, similarly, when the clamping block is newly inserted into the clamping groove, the elasticity of the first spring can be utilized to drive the first limiting rod to be newly installed in the first limiting groove, and the stability after installation can be improved.

Background
The fire-fighting boots are excellent protective capability to high temperature, heat flow and flame, the boots surface is resistant to 2W/cm2 heat flow for three minutes, the fire-fighting boots generally exist with the fire department, be used for actions such as fire fighting, rescue, etc., the fire-fighting boots have the effect of protecting the human body and human foot and shank, the fire-fighting boots are owing to its peculiar design, make the fire fighter when rescuing the conflagration, not only protect the health not receive the damage, and the antiskid, be suitable for walking on various surfaces, the rescue efficiency of fire fighter has been improved greatly, and in the use, current novel alert armed fire-fighting boots have many problems or defects:
traditional novel armed police fire boots are in the in-service use, and the upper end opening of most of fire boots leg of a boot is great, and the fire fighter can't guarantee to keep laminating with different size firemen's shank when using the fire boots, is unfavorable for firemen's rescue work, and the while is often needed to destroy article such as some doors and windows at the scene of fire firemen, and ordinary fire boots are too soft, and the destructive power is relatively poor, has reduced firemen's work efficiency.
